Becky (Frey) Kidd’06 has spent the past 20 years shaping young minds as a 4th grade teacher in Frederick County Public Schools. Known for creating classrooms centered on literacy, creativity, and kindness, she inspires students through innovative learning experiences like “Book A Day” read-alouds and author Skype visits. Beyond the classroom, Becky has served as a grade-level lead, master teacher, and curriculum writer, impacting both students and fellow educators across FCPS. Her passion, dedication, and care leave a lasting impression on every child she teaches!

Mike O’Brien ’00 is wrapping up his 26th year as a teacher and coach, earning national, regional, and state honors in 2025, including National Unified Sports Coach of the Year and Maryland State Coach of the Year. He also received SHAPE Maryland Teacher of the Year and was named a Teacher of the Year semifinalist.

At Tuscarora High School, he serves as department chair for health and physical education, advises the Best Buddies club, started unified PE and sports programs, and has supported athletics for over 15 years as assistant athletic director.
